Here is what we are learning the week of 2/10:
Reading/ELA- Recount stories, including fables and folktales from diverse cultures, and determines their central message, lesson, or moral.
Writing- Opinion writing; we are working on writing opinion pieces that introduce a topic or book, state an opinion, supply reasons that include linking words (because, and, also) and provide a concluding statement.
Math- Solving One Step Word Problems; Consistently and independently uses addition and subtraction to solve one and two step word problems within 100.
Science- Students will investigate how shadows, moon phases, and length of day change over various time periods.
STEAM –Monarch Garden Plans.
